An ink tank for being installed in an ink jet recording apparatus to supply ink thereto, including an ink storage portion, one side surface of a casing of the ink tank in which side surface an opening for supplying ink to the apparatus is formed, and a joint member for joining the one side surface to the apparatus by engaging with a connection member of the apparatus. The joint member has a welding portion for being welded to the one side surface along a peripheral portion of the opening, the welding portion corresponding to the peripheral portion; and a hollow portion forming a positioning hole for inserting therein and engaging therewith the connection member for determining a relative position of the apparatus and the one side surface. The hollow portion is provided on the outside of the welding portion and abuts to the one side surface without being welded.

A method of producing a liquid cartridge having an identification part corresponding to a type of liquid held inside the liquid cartridge, the method includes preparing the liquid cartridge having a plurality of protrusions protruding from an external wall; and forming the identification part corresponding to the type of liquid by melting at least one of the protrusions. In this way, a strong mis-loading prevention part that prevents mis-loading of the liquid cartridge into a liquid consuming apparatus can be constituted without generating waste.

A carrier for use in the catalyst for the production of an epoxide is obtained by preparing a carrier precursor containing (a) α-alumina, (b) silicon or a compound thereof, and (c) at least one element selected from the class consisting of germanium, tin, lead, phosphorus, antimony, and bismuth or a compound thereof and subsequently heat-treating the precursor in non-oxidative gas. The catalyst for the production of the epoxide is obtained by having silver deposited on this carrier and the epoxide is obtained from a corresponding unsaturated hydrocarbon of 2–4 carbon atoms with a high selectivity by using the catalyst.

A monolithic organic porous body includes a continuous macropore structure that includes cellular macropores that overlap to form openings having an average diameter of 20 to 200 μm, the monolithic organic porous body having a thickness of 1 mm or more and a total pore volume of 0.5 to 5 ml/g, an area of a skeleton observed within an SEM image of a section of the continuous macropore structure (in a dry state) being 25 to 50%. A monolithic ion exchanger is produced by introducing an ion-exchange group into the monolithic organic porous body. The monolithic organic porous body and the monolithic ion exchanger are chemically stable, have high mechanical strength, and ensure a low pressure loss when fluid passes through. The monolithic organic porous body and the monolithic ion exchanger may be used as an adsorbent having a large adsorption capacity or an ion exchanger having a large ion-exchange capacity.

A catalyst for the production of ethylene oxide is formed by causing a carrier having &agr;-alumina as a main component thereof to incorporate therein silica and a metal or a compound of at least one element selected from the elements of the groups Ib and IIb in the periodic table of the elements such as, for example, silver oxide and depositing silver on the carrier. The carrier is obtained by mixing at least &agr;-alumina, a silicon compound, an organic binder, and a compound of at least one element selected from the elements of the groups Ib and IIb in the periodical table of the elements and then calcining the resultant mixture at a temperature in the range of 1,000°-1,800° C.
